- [ ] Confirm the nightly search reindex for Quillbase completed before the 02:00 cutover. Support should verify that stale results no longer appear for merchant catalogs updated yesterday. If customers report missing listings, escalate to the Findery crew rather than re-running the job manually. The reindex run can be confirmed against the token below.

pipeline stamp: htk31_f769b577b3028a4e9958e5bb8d1259a

QUARTERLY PLANNING NOTE — Sales Leads

Subject: Term Sheet from Halbrecht Systems

Halbrecht Systems has submitted a revised term sheet for the co-sell arrangement covering the Quillon product line. Margins improve modestly; exclusivity language remains under negotiation. Please avoid committing pricing to prospects in affected segments until counsel completes review. The confidential summary of our negotiating position is set out below.

confidential, kajof-tahof: The pricing group signed off on a budget of $491.8 million for Project Casvan.

Handover: Tessellate timetable solver (Rooksfield schools pilot). Solver core is a CP-SAT wrapper; constraint weights live in weights.yaml — teacher availability dominates, room capacity is soft. Nightly runs regenerate drafts; manual overrides persist in the overrides table. Known issue: split-lunch cohorts occasionally double-book lab B. The admin account used for emergency re-solves is recovered via the passphrase below.

vault phrase of bagaf-kajeg = jorath-feniel-briir-siliel-ralix

## Visitor Handling — Front Desk (Marlowe House)

All visitors to Quellerton Systems must sign in at the front desk and receive a day badge from the tray under the counter. Confirm their host by checking the Novaplan calendar; never let visitors proceed unescorted. Day badges open the lobby turnstile only. If a visitor needs the lift lobby before their host arrives, escort them personally using your own pass. For after-hours arrivals, use the override code below.

door code, hahog-tadup: bdg-ND-9